Synopsis

All of humanity were turned into dungeon cores. The goal was to carefully filter enemy forces through our defenses so that the world would have a chance of surviving an apocalyptic extradimensional invasion.

Well, that was the overall situation. For me though, it was a chance to finally escape the fate I'd trapped myself in. A chance to leave the past behind, to reach out, to make magic.

But then again... Everything that was within my reach, was so close to being lost forever. Is it really possible to change?

    The story is a bit of a slog. 100k words written, very little said. Extremely inefficient storytelling, which is par for the course with webnovels. Ultimately, if you've read dungeon core novels, you'll find some decent ideas that just aren't ever executed. Nothings happened, and I don't know if it ever will. Most of the story feels like filler, and it could be said with a lot less words.

    The M.C. Is hard to relate to. She has anxiety and depression, but with 100k words hasn't experienced any personal growth. Or decline. She's exactly the same as when the story started.

    The beginning is an info dump. Gives a bunch of tables and stats that aren't pertinent or relevant. And that's the story in a nutshell. It can't even be called a slice of life story because the pace is literally glacier. 5 days passed. No life has happened XD.
